3. Biodata:
Tokhi_Zahra_ZabuliMrs. Zahra Tokhi Zabuli Zuhra Tokhi is the Daughter of Abdul Rahman and was born 1969 in Zabul Province. Currently she is living in Kabul. Zabuli completed her secondary education at the Bibi Khala High School in Zabul province in 1986. She earned her bachelor’s degree in Dentistry at the University of Kyrgyzstan in 2005. She is a Dentist. During the war period, she immigrated to Pakistan, and then to Kyrgyzstan. She lived in Kyrgyzstan for seven years and completed university there. Zabuli returned to Afghanistan in 2005. Zuhra Tokhi is the sister of Daud Hassas, the former spokesman of Chief Executive Abdullah Abdullah during the first two years of the National Unity Government (NUG).

The district governor of Shamulzayi district is the brother of Zuhra Tokhi.
 

Zabuli is an independent member of the Wolesi Jirga 2010.
 

Commission (2012): Immunities and Privileges (Secretary)

Zahrah Tokhi received 482 votes in Wolesi Jirga 2018 election and got a seat in WJ 2018. She is a pro-Ghani member of parliament.
 

Zabuli is married and has four sons and two daughters.
 

She speaks Pashtu, Dari, English and Russian.
